The Microlife Kroger BP3NL1-1AKRO is an upper-arm blood pressure monitor featuring Microlife's patented AFIB detection technology, one-touch operation, Intellisense for comfortable inflation, a large LCD display with backlight, memory storage for multiple users, irregular heartbeat detection, WHO blood pressure classification indicator, and date/time function. It is designed for accurate, at-home blood pressure and pulse monitoring. Below are key sections for safety, features, setup, operation, maintenance, and troubleshooting.
Key components: Main unit with LCD display, Arm cuff with D-Ring, AC power adapter, Instruction manual, Storage case.
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| AFIB Detection | Patented technology to screen for possible Atrial Fibrillation |
| Intellisense | Automatic inflation to the ideal pressure for comfortable measurement |
| One-Touch Operation | Simple start/stop measurement with a single button |
| Large LCD with Backlight | Easy-to-read display for day or night use |
| Multi-User Memory | Stores readings for two users separately |
| WHO Indicator | Color-coded bar graph showing blood pressure classification |
| Irregular Heartbeat Detection | Alerts user to irregular heartbeats during measurement |
| Date & Time Stamp | Records the time and date of each measurement |
| Automatic Power Off | Conserves battery life |

The device stores up to 99 measurements for each of the two users, with date and time stamp.
Refer to the WHO classification bar on the display:
| Color Zone | Blood Pressure Category | Systolic/Diastolic Range |
|---|---|---|
| Blue | Low | < 120 / < 80 mmHg |
| Green | Normal | 120-129 / 80-84 mmHg |
| Yellow | High-Normal | 130-139 / 85-89 mmHg |
| Orange | Grade 1 Hypertension | 140-159 / 90-99 mmHg |
| Red | Grade 2 Hypertension | 160-179 / 100-109 mmHg |
| Flashing Red | Grade 3 Hypertension | ≥ 180 / ≥ 110 mmHg |
Symbols: A heart with an 'E' icon indicates an irregular heartbeat detected. The AFIB symbol indicates a possible Atrial Fibrillation event was detected during the measurement. Consult your physician if these symbols appear frequently.

| Symptom | Possible Cause | Corrective Action |
|---|---|---|
| Display is blank | Dead batteries, improper connection | Replace batteries; ensure AC adapter is plugged in firmly. |
| Error Code 'E' appears | Cuff not attached, air leak | Ensure cuff tube is connected securely. Check cuff for holes. |
| Error Code 'EEEE' | Measurement error | Remain still and retry. Ensure cuff is at heart level. |
| Inconsistent readings | Incorrect posture, movement | Sit correctly with arm supported at heart level. Do not move during measurement. |
| Device does not inflate | Blocked air tube, weak batteries | Check tube for kinks. Replace batteries. |
| Memory not saving | Memory full, user not selected | Clear memory for the current user. Ensure correct user (1 or 2) is selected. |
Reset: Remove batteries and AC adapter for 5 minutes, then reinsert.
